The Role

We are looking to augment our digital development team with a technical business analyst to help form the bridge between business requirements and technical solutions. This role combines expertise in digital technologies, agile methodologies, and project management to drive successful outcomes in complex technical environments.

Key Responsibilities

Lead requirements gathering sessions with stakeholders to understand business needs and integration requirements.

Analyze and design solutions in a dynamic cross functional team of expertise.

Document comprehensive business requirements documents, user stories, and functional specifications.

Collaborate with technical teams to design solutions

Facilitate communication between business stakeholders, development teams, and quality assurance teams throughout the project lifecycle.

Conduct impact analysis and risk assessment for proposed changes to existing solutions.

Manage project knowledge and perform integrated change control throughout the project lifecycle.

Qualifications

Proven experience as a technical business analyst, ideally with 5 years of experience or more.

Experience in eCommerce.

Significant understanding of technologies such as API's, cloud solutions, and common CRUD based integrations.

Strong understanding of integration patterns using REST, SOAP, JSON, XML.

Extensive experience with agile methodologies and tools (SCRUM, JIRA, etc)

Knowledge of process modeling techniques.

Experience with prototyping or wireframing tools such as Figma or Balsamiq

Strong project management skills like planning, organization, and critical thinking.

Excellent analytical, problem solving, and communication skills.

Self-Starter with excellent communications skills

Excellent ability to build relationships with technology and business stakeholders
